"""E1 (PLAN_SELFPACED): learned per-prompt halting over the workspace loop. HaltingMergeAdapter = frozen-recipe MergeAdapter + a halting head read off the workspace state at the last prompt position after each iteration: p_i = sigmoid(w · [e_last ; s_hat_i,last] + b) (halt after iter i) q_i = p_i * prod_{j suffix -> CE, plus a compute penalty lambda * E[iters] = lambda * sum_i q_i * i. The halting head's weight is zero-init and its bias starts at -6 (p ~ 0.0025), so at init >=98% of the mass sits on k_max: the model is approximately the fixed-k merge (documented tolerance, not bit-exact). Deploy: iterate until cumulative halt mass crosses 0.5; per-item k*.
